In a move towards greater transparency in the property market, the Residential Property Price Register is now available. The Register, which provides information on all residential properties purchased in the Republic of Ireland since 1 January 2010, has been compiled by the Property Services Regulatory Authority, using information declared to the Revenue Commissioners for stamp duty purposes. The Register, which is updated on a regular basis, includes the following information:

  • Address
  • Date of sale
  • Price
  • Description of property i.e. whether it is new or second-hand
  • Property size/ description
  • Other properties in the sale

The Property Size/ Description information is limited and is not completed in all cases.

It is hoped that the register will restore confidence to the market by improving the quality of information available in the residential property market.
